[gnome-keyring/trust-store] [egg] Fix uninitialized list pointers.



commit 25ff96c134937f0fa08c73334346c0709c94180e
Author: Stef Walter <stefw collabora co uk>
Date:   Wed Dec 22 15:22:09 2010 +0000

    [egg] Fix uninitialized list pointers.

 egg/egg-asn1x.c |    2 ++
 1 files changed, 2 insertions(+), 0 deletions(-)
---
diff --git a/egg/egg-asn1x.c b/egg/egg-asn1x.c
index 23a23f0..ba0a398 100644
--- a/egg/egg-asn1x.c
+++ b/egg/egg-asn1x.c
@@ -3578,6 +3578,7 @@ traverse_and_prepare (GNode *node, gpointer data)
 			g_node_append (node, child);
 		}
 		g_list_free (list);
+		list = NULL;
 	}
 
 	/* Lookup the max set size */
@@ -3625,6 +3626,7 @@ traverse_and_prepare (GNode *node, gpointer data)
 		for (l = list; l; l = g_list_next (l))
 			g_node_append (node, l->data);
 		g_list_free (list);
+		list = NULL;
 	}
 
 	/* Continue traversal */



[Date Prev][Date Next]   [Thread Prev][Thread Next]   [Thread Index] [Date Index] [Author Index]